  • Q1. What is single source authoring
  • Ans. 

    Single source authoring is a content development approach where information is created once and then reused across multiple outputs.

    • Single source authoring allows for efficient content creation and maintenance.

    • It reduces redundancy and ensures consistency in information.

    • Examples of single source authoring tools include MadCap Flare, Adobe RoboHelp, and DITA XML.

  • Q2. Explain DITA CMS
  • Ans. 

    DITA CMS is a content management system specifically designed for managing DITA-based technical documentation.

    • DITA CMS allows for the creation, organization, and publishing of DITA content.

    • It provides version control, workflow management, and collaboration features.

    • DITA CMS enables reuse of content components, ensuring consistency and efficiency.

Interview preparation tips for other job seekers - The HR asks our convenient time for the interview and schedules it, but the panel won't be available. I had to wait on the WebEx for a long time and disconnect. After the cleared the first round, the same thing happened in the 2nd round. This time the HR atleast informed me about the change in timings 10 min before the interview.
During the interview, I felt as if I was being grilled. The panel did not read my resume properly and had poor listening skills. For every question they asked, I had to clarify what was written in my resume. They could have saved time by reading it properly. They asked me the same questions again and again.

  • Q3. What is the difference between Binary Search Trees (BST) and Tries?
  • Ans. 

    BST is a binary tree structure where each node has at most two children, while Tries are tree structures used for storing strings.

    • BST is used for searching, inserting, and deleting elements in a sorted manner.

    • Tries are used for storing and searching strings efficiently.

    • BST has a hierarchical structure with left and right child nodes.

    • Tries have nodes representing characters, forming a tree-like structure for strings.

  • Q3. What is indexing in the context of databases?
  • Ans. 

    Indexing in databases is a technique used to improve the speed of data retrieval by creating a data structure that allows for quick lookups.

    • Indexes are created on specific columns in a database table to speed up queries that search for data in those columns.

    • Indexes work similar to the index of a book, allowing the database to quickly locate the desired data without having to scan the entire table.

  • Q4. Which data structure is better for your use case: a B Tree or a Hash Table?
  • Ans. 

    Hash Table is better for fast lookups and insertions, while B Tree is better for range queries and ordered traversal.

    • Use Hash Table for fast lookups and insertions with O(1) average time complexity.

    • Use B Tree for range queries and ordered traversal with O(log n) time complexity.

    • Consider the size of the dataset and the specific operations needed to determine the best data structure.
